Patinack Farm head trainer John Thompson is hoping lightning can strike twice in Perth on Saturday. 12 months ago Thompson prepared Gathering (Tale Of The Cat) to win the Railway Handicap (Gr 1) when ridden by Craig Williams and Williams, fresh from riding four winners at Sandown Park in Melbourne last Saturday, will be aboard Saint Encosta for Patinack Farm in the $80,000 Tattersalls Cup (Listed) over 2100m.

Saint Encosta finished a creditable seventh over 1800m at Flemington on Oaks Day and he is preparing for the Perth Cup over 2400m. “He was slowly away at Flemington so I’m hoping Craig can get him away from the gates and then see him finish off.” Thompson says. “His main aim is the Perth Cup so a nice run here will be a bonus.”

The Tattersalls Cup is Race 5 at 1.45pm local time and Saint Encosta has drawn barrier 11 in a field of 14.
